A well-established equipment service provider in Brampton, ON, is hiring an Experienced Heavy Equipment Service Technician to repair and maintain snow removal equipment. Ideal candidates have strong diagnostic skills in hydraulics, electrical, and mechanical systems. Apply today to join a skilled and customer-focused service team!

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• 5+ years’ experience servicing heavy trucks or heavy equipment.
  • Skilled in hydraulic, pneumatic, electrical, and lighting systems.
  • Ability to interpret mechanical, electrical, and hydraulic schematics.
  • 310T, 421A, or 425A certification strongly preferred but not required.
  • Valid G-class driver’s license considered an asset.
  • Mobile Handling Equipment certification preferred.
  • Proficient with Word, Excel, Outlook, and Teams.

Responsibilities
  • Diagnose, troubleshoot, and repair hydraulic, mechanical, electrical, and control systems on mobile equipment.
  • Perform preventative and corrective maintenance in-shop and at customer sites.
  • Conduct inspections, calibrations, and functional tests before releasing equipment.
  • Respond to urgent service calls, including potential seasonal overtime.
  • Communicate findings, service recommendations, and solutions to customers.
  • Document repairs, labor hours, and parts used in internal systems.
  • Support warranty claims with detailed reports, root cause analysis, and photographic evidence.
  • Identify and report recurring equipment or field issues to internal teams.
